    Here are answers to some common questions about proactive Preventive Dental care with Dr. Pablo DMD:

    How often should I visit the dentist for a check-up and cleaning?
    Dr. Pablo DMD recommends seeing a dentist and hygienist every six months for a checkup and cleaning. This schedule is crucial for removing tartar buildup that brushing can't, catching cavities early, and identifying potential gum disease or oral cancer.
    Why are routine dental cleanings so important for prevention?
    Even with excellent brushing and flossing, plaque hardens into tartar that only a professional cleaning can remove. This process is crucial for preventing cavities and, more importantly, gum disease, which is linked to other health problems like heart disease.
    How is oral health connected to my overall health?
    Your oral health is intrinsically linked to your overall well-being. Chronic gum inflammation (periodontitis) has been linked to an increased risk of heart disease, stroke, and poorly controlled diabetes. Preventive dental care is essential for maintaining optimal systemic health.
    What are dental implants?
    Dental implants are the modern gold standard for replacing missing teeth. They are titanium posts that act like artificial tooth roots, which are then topped with a natural-looking crown. This helps prevent bone loss and preserves the health of surrounding teeth.
    Can you help with snoring or sleep apnea?
    Dr. Pablo DMD can help with some cases of sleep-disordered breathing. For some patients with mild to moderate obstructive sleep apnea, we can create a custom-fitted oral appliance to keep the airway open while you sleep. This is a comfortable and effective alternative to CPAP for eligible patients.
    What is TMJ disorder?
    Temporomandibular Joint (TMJ) disorder affects the jaw joint and the muscles that control jaw movement. Common symptoms include jaw pain, clicking or popping sounds, and headaches. Dr. Pablo DMD can help diagnose the issue and recommend treatments like a custom nightguard to prevent damage from teeth grinding.
    What are dental sealants, and who should get them?
    Dental sealants are a thin, protective plastic coating applied to the chewing surfaces of back teeth. They are a powerful preventive tool, primarily for children and teenagers, that seal out food and plaque to prevent cavities from forming in the deep grooves of the teeth.
    What is the difference between gingivitis and periodontitis?
    Gingivitis is an early, reversible stage of gum disease characterized by red, swollen gums that may bleed easily. If left untreated, gingivitis can progress to periodontitis, a more serious stage where the bone supporting your teeth is damaged, potentially leading to tooth loss.
